Halloween started as an ancient festival what was it called
Wittaler [7]

Answer:

The All Saints' Day celebration was also called All-hallows or All-hallowmas (from Middle English Alholowmesse meaning All Saints' Day) and the night before it, the traditional night of Samhain in the Celtic religion, began to be called All-Hallows Eve and, eventually, Halloween.

What artist created the image above?
Tamiku [17]

Answer:

kathe Kollwitz

Explanation:

Peasant War was Kollwitz’s second major cycle of prints, which occupied her from 1902 to 1908. She had been appointed to teach graphics at the Berlin School for Women due to the success of her previous print cycle, known as The Weaver’s Revolt. This next series was commissioned by the Association of Historical Art. The title refers to the violent uprising of peasants against their feudal lords and the church which took place in the early years of the Reformation in Southern Germany (1522–25). In a letter to a friend she noted that she had read The General History of the Great Peasant’s War written in 1841– 42 by Wilhelm Zimmermann and had become fascinated by the legendary figure known as Black Anna who was said to have incited the insurrection. Kollwitz noted that she identified with this character who appears in this print urging the peasants forward, arms raised over her head.
